Mountain Music Entertainment presents an Evening of Bluegrass at White Horse Black Mountain (NC) on April 16th at 8pm. The evening will feature two headliner acts, Grasstowne and Ralph Stanley II.  Grasstowne will be celebrating their new album release for KICKIN UP DUST (Rural Rhythm Records) that evening.  The band is comprised of well respected veterans in bluegrass and acoustic music, Alan Bibey and Steve Gulley, who have known and admired each other for over 25 years in their endeavors with bands such as The New Quicksilver, IIIrd Tyme Out, Doyle Lawson & Quicksilver, BlueRidge and Mountain Heart. Add to the band’s mix three young and very talented players: Adam Haynes on fiddle and vocals, Justin Jenkins on banjo and vocals and Kameron Keller on upright bass and you have one of the hottest and energetic bands touring today. Grammy Award winning Ralph Stanley II, who’s known as “Two” to his friends, spent nearly half his 30 plus years as lead singer and rhythm guitarist for his father’s fabled bluegrass band, Dr. Ralph Stanley and the Clinch Mountain Boys. But like the great vocalist Keith Whitley, who preceded him in that position, Stanley has always had a passion for hardcore country songs, the ones that never wear thin from repeated singing. He is now fronting his own band doing a blend of bluegrass and county style songs old and new.  With multiple awards and recognitions under his belt, Ralph II is looking to release his new project later this year.
